Transaction e8807708ecde1840482642fba2b814d902e1ee64b77c074be046c6454ae62e65

1 Input
2 Outputs
  • e8807708ecde1840482642fba2b814d902e1ee64b77c074be046c6454ae62e65:0
  • value  588303
    address  1PxCTKUecokv3UP1cCbSe1o4WK8bFDcqNa
  • e8807708ecde1840482642fba2b814d902e1ee64b77c074be046c6454ae62e65:1
  • value  2825274686
    address  3EwTn8ACyGrw1z4thSZ6yVxEVvqe6D4gA5